About This paperback
A fascinating and absorbing book, accessible even to those readers without a scientific or theological background, John Polkinghorne draws on his own wide-ranging experience as physicist and priest to investigate how both spirituality and science contribute to our understanding of the ‘reality’ in which we live. While looking at many features of our modern, material lives, he explores what it means to be human, and how a crucial search for truth - whether scientific of theological - is to our existence.
Using as entry-points issues of contemporary concern (such as genetic ethics, as well as attitudes between different faiths), Dr Polkinghorne examines what it means to be truly human. He ends this compelling exploration of the beliefs behind our modern lives with an enlightening discussion on the scientific possibilities of a life after death.
